Athens Embraces Chinese-Funded Photovoltaic Energy Storage System for Sustainable Future
Why Athens' New Solar Storage Project Matters
As Athens accelerates its transition to renewable energy, the Chinese-funded photovoltaic energy storage system has emerged as a game-changer. Designed to stabilize Greece's power grid while reducing carbon emissions, this project exemplifies how cross-border collaborations can reshape urban energy landscapes. Let's unpack why this initiative is making waves in Southern Europe.
Key Drivers Behind the Project
- Addressing solar intermittency through advanced battery storage
- Meeting EU's 2030 renewable energy targets
- Reducing reliance on imported fossil fuels
- Creating local jobs in green tech sectors
Global Energy Storage Trends & Athens' Position
The global energy storage market is projected to grow at a 23.5% CAGR through 2030, driven by:
- Falling lithium-ion battery costs (down 89% since 2010)
- Smart grid integration requirements
- Demand for frequency regulation in power networks
| Athens Project Metrics | Data |
|---|---|
| Total Capacity | 48 MWh |
| Chinese Investment | €18 million |
| CO2 Reduction | 12,000 tons/year |
| Peak Load Support | 6,500 households |
Technical Innovations in Action
This system employs liquid-cooled battery cabinets with 95% round-trip efficiency – imagine a high-performance "energy bank" that stores solar power during daylight and releases it during evening peaks. The integration of AI-powered energy management systems enables real-time grid balancing, a critical feature for cities with aging infrastructure.

FAQ: Athens Solar Storage System
- Q: How does this differ from traditional solar farms?A: Integrated storage enables 24/7 power supply, overcoming solar's daytime limitation.
- Q: What safety measures are implemented?A: Multi-layer protection including thermal runaway prevention and fire suppression systems.
- Q: Can existing solar plants add storage retroactively?A: Yes, through modular battery additions and DC coupling upgrades.
